**Break-Glass Access — Lanternmere Broker Upgrade**

If the Corvid message broker upgrade stalls mid-rollout and normal admin credentials are unavailable, on-call may use break-glass access to finish or roll back the upgrade. This bypasses the approval queue, so every action is recorded to the immutable audit stream. Confirm the broker cluster is actually unreachable through standard channels before proceeding, and notify the duty lead afterward. To activate break-glass mode on the Lanternmere console, enter the recovery passphrase shown below.

vault phrase of bagaf-kajeg = jorath-feniel-briir-siliel-ralix

Meeting notes — 12 Mar, facilities sync
Attendees agreed the Dunmere Annex master keys go out this week. Keys stay in the tamper-evident pouch; coordinator signs the custody sheet before release. Varno Transit assigned the run, driver TBC. No duplicates exist, so no reissue if lost. Coordinator must relay the hand-over instruction below to the driver at pick-up.

courier memo of yawep-yafog: the pramir ulaix courier leaves the ulavan aldix frair zorok oliiel joreth rusdor fenvan ledger at gate 1305 under passcode 514738

## Deploying the Gatewick Proctor Queue

Deploys are pretty painless: push to main, wait for the pipeline, then watch the queue drain dashboard for five minutes. If candidates pile up mid-exam, roll back first and ask questions later — the queue replays safely. Everything the workers care about lives in one config block, shown here for reference.

settings of bafof-yagef:
JOROX_PIN=8740
JOROX_TENANT=pelox
JOROX_METRICS_HOST=metrics.jorox.qorvelworks.internal
JOROX_SEAL=seal_c78f63c1
JOROX_STANDBY_TEAM=norax

**Ticket: Vault locked during blue-green cutover**

Hey — mid-review favor. The Copperline billing worker's blue-green deploy stalled because the secrets vault auto-locked when green came up. Blue is still serving, so no customer impact, but we can't finish the swap until the vault reopens. Please eyeball my unlock script in the branch too. To unseal, enter the passphrase below.

unlock words, fafop-hawep: briwyn-oliix-sorox